This kit was built by a friend many years ago, standing on a shelf since then so there was a lot of dust!

Now I have tried to clean and restore it. I used decals from S27 for the Argentinian GP of -72.

Painted with Tamiya spraycan recomended for this kit, replaced the smaller type of tires to the bigger ones

that was used from -72. Also I added rivets, hoses, hosebands ,alurods,valves and some wireing too.

The most difficult part was to paint Ceverts helmet ! Long from perfect but it will do.
